If you do not wish to do so, delete this +exception statement from your version. */ + + +package gnu.java.security.key.dss; + +import gnu.java.lang.CPStringBuilder; + +import gnu.java.security.Registry; +import gnu.java.security.action.GetPropertyAction; +import gnu.java.security.util.FormatUtil; + +import java.math.BigInteger; +import java.security.AccessController; +import java.security.Key; +import java.security.interfaces.DSAKey; +import java.security.interfaces.DSAParams; +import java.security.spec.DSAParameterSpec; + +/** + * A base asbtract class for both public and private DSS (Digital Signature + * Standard) keys. It encapsulates the three DSS numbers: p, + * q and g. + *

+ * According to the JDK, cryptographic Keys all have a format. + * The format used in this implementation is called Raw, and basically + * consists of the raw byte sequences of algorithm parameters. The exact order + * of the byte sequences and the implementation details are given in each of the + * relevant getEncoded() methods of each of the private and + * public keys. + *

+ * IMPORTANT: Under certain circumstances (e.g. in an X.509 certificate + * with inherited AlgorithmIdentifier's parameters of a SubjectPublicKeyInfo + * element) these three MPIs may be null. + * + * @see DSSPrivateKey#getEncoded + * @see DSSPublicKey#getEncoded + */ +public abstract class DSSKey + implements Key, DSAKey +{ + /** + * A prime modulus, where + * 2L-1 < p < 2L for + * 512 <= L <= 1024 and L a multiple of + * 64. + */ + protected final BigInteger p; + + /** + * A prime divisor of p - 1, where + * 2159 < q + * < 2160. + */ + protected final BigInteger q; + + /** + * g = h(p-1)/q mod p, where h is + * any integer with 1 < h < p - 1 such that h + * (p-1)/q mod p > 1 (g + * has order q mod p + * ). + */ + protected final BigInteger g; + + /** + * Identifier of the default encoding format to use when externalizing the key + * material. + */ + protected final int defaultFormat; + + /** String representation of this key. Cached for speed. */ + private transient String str; + + /** + * Trivial protected constructor. + * + * @param defaultFormat the identifier of the encoding format to use by + * default when externalizing the key. + * @param p the DSS parameter p. + * @param q the DSS parameter q. + * @param g the DSS parameter g. + */ + protected DSSKey(int defaultFormat, BigInteger p, BigInteger q, BigInteger g) + { + super(); + + this.defaultFormat = defaultFormat <= 0 ? Registry.RAW_ENCODING_ID + : defaultFormat; + this.p = p; + this.q = q; + this.g = g; + } + + public DSAParams getParams() + { + return new DSAParameterSpec(p, q, g); + } + + public String getAlgorithm() + { + return Registry.DSS_KPG; + } + + /** @deprecated see getEncoded(int). */ + public byte[] getEncoded() + { + return getEncoded(defaultFormat); + } + + public String getFormat() + { + return FormatUtil.getEncodingShortName(defaultFormat); + } + + /** + * Returns true if the designated object is an instance of + * {@link DSAKey} and has the same DSS (Digital Signature Standard) parameter + * values as this one. + *

+ * Always returns false if the MPIs of this key are + * inherited. This may be the case when the key is re-constructed from + * an X.509 certificate with absent or NULL AlgorithmIdentifier's parameters + * field. + * + * @param obj the other non-null DSS key to compare to. + * @return true if the designated object is of the same type + * and value as this one. + */ + public boolean equals(Object obj) + { + if (hasInheritedParameters()) + return false; + + if (obj == null) + return false; + + if (! (obj instanceof DSAKey)) + return false; + + DSAKey that = (DSAKey) obj; + return p.equals(that.getParams().getP()) + && q.equals(that.getParams().getQ()) + && g.equals(that.getParams().getG()); + } + + public String toString() + { + if (str == null) + { + String ls = (String) AccessController.doPrivileged(new GetPropertyAction("line.separator")); + CPStringBuilder sb = new CPStringBuilder(ls) + .append("defaultFormat=").append(defaultFormat).append(",") + .append(ls); + if (hasInheritedParameters()) + sb.append("p=inherited,").append(ls) + .append("q=inherited,").append(ls) + .append("g=inherited"); + else + sb.append("p=0x").append(p.toString(16)).append(",").append(ls) + .append("q=0x").append(q.toString(16)).append(",").append(ls) + .append("g=0x").append(g.toString(16)); + str = sb.toString(); + } + return str; + } + + public abstract byte[] getEncoded(int format); + + /** + * @return true if p, q and + * g are all null. Returns + * false otherwise. + */ + public boolean hasInheritedParameters() + { + return p == null && q == null && g == null; + } +} -- cgit v1.2.3
